The average occupancy for nursing homes in Madison, CT is 88.3%, with 80 resident days occupying 135 available monthly beds.
The average nursing home cost is $242.64 per day in Madison, CT, with an average cost-to-charge ratio of 2.48.
Registered Nurses (RN) spend an average of 52.0 minutes with each resident per day at nursing homes in Madison, CT.
Licensed Practical Nurses (LPN) spend an average of 41.0 minutes with each resident per day at nursing homes in Madison, CT.
Certified Nursing Assistants (CNA) spend an average of 120.3 minutes with each resident per day at nursing homes in Madison, CT.
Physical Therapists (PT) spend an average of 4.6 minutes with each resident per day at nursing homes in Madison, CT.
Direct care staff spend an average of 211 minutes with each resident per day at nursing homes in Madison, CT.
The average length of stay for Medicare Residents (Title 18 beneficiaries) at nursing homes in Madison, CT is 22.81 days.
The average length of stay for Medicaid Residents (Title 19 beneficiaries) at nursing homes in Madison, CT is 263.31 days.
Resident days by insurance coverage are based on 3,633 Medicare days, 28,614 Medicaid days, and 5,302 Medicare Advantage / Private Pay / Other days out of 49,275 total available days at nursing homes in Madison, CT.
